On hot sunny days asphalt, tarmac and pavements can become too hot for your dog’s paws, causing pain and burns, so at what temperature can you take your dog for a walk, how can you tell if the ground is too hot and what can you do to protect your dog’s paws from the heat? Can pavements be too hot for dogs to walk on? It certainly is possible, but before you and your dog hit the streets, it is necessary to take precautions to ensure that the hot asphalt pavement is not damaging your dog’s paws.
